How to: Configure Virus Filtering¶
InterWorx uses ClamAV to detect viruses entering the server via email. ClamAV’s SMTP level virus scanning scans messages as they come in. This allows ClamAV to stop threats before they ever reach the system. If ClamAV detects a virus, the SMTP service automatically rejects the message.

To Manage the ClamAV Service¶
Checking ClamAV Status¶
Warning
If SMTP virus scanning is enabled, but the ClamAV service is stopped, all incoming mail will temporarily be rejected from the server until either the ClamAV service is restarted or SMTP virus scanning is disabled.
Log into NodeWorx from the browser (https://ip.ad.dr.ess:2443/nodeworx)
In NodeWorx, navigate to System Services > Mail Server > Virus Filtering
Under ClamAV Control, the ClamAV Status bar indicates the current status of the service
It is also possible to control the status of the service from this interface:
Play starts the service
Arrow restarts/refreshes the service
Stop stops the service
Setting ClamAV Start-On-Boot Options¶
Log into NodeWorx from the browser (https://ip.ad.dr.ess:2443/nodeworx)
In NodeWorx, navigate to System Services > Mail Server > Virus Filtering
Under ClamAV Control, select either Yes or No from the Start on Boot-up dropdown
Click Update
Setting ClamAV Auto-Restart Options¶
Log into NodeWorx from the browser (https://ip.ad.dr.ess:2443/nodeworx)
In NodeWorx, navigate to System Services > Mail Server > Virus Filtering
Under ClamAV Control, select either Yes or No from the Auto-restart ClamAV dropdown
Click Update
To Manage the Freshclam Virus Update Daemon¶
Freshclam is the automatic virus definition update service used by ClamAV. If this is enabled, ClamAV will always have the most recent virus definitions.
Checking Freshclam Status¶
Log into NodeWorx from the browser (https://ip.ad.dr.ess:2443/nodeworx)
In NodeWorx, navigate to System Services > Mail Server > Virus Filtering
Under Freshclam Control, the Freshclam Status bar indicates the current status of the service
It is also possible to control the status of the service from this interface:
Play starts the service
Arrow restarts/refreshes the service
Stop stops the service
Setting Freshclam Start-On-Boot Options¶
Log into NodeWorx from the browser (https://ip.ad.dr.ess:2443/nodeworx)
In NodeWorx, navigate to System Services > Mail Server > Virus Filtering
Under Freshclam Control, select either Yes or No from the Start on Boot-up dropdown
Click Update
To Manage SMTP Virus Scanning¶
Note
The ClamAV and Freshclam daemons will automatically start when SMTP scanning is enabled.
Log into NodeWorx from the browser (https://ip.ad.dr.ess:2443/nodeworx)
In NodeWorx, navigate to System Services > Mail Server > Virus Filtering
Under ClamAV Options, Select Enabled or Disabled from the SMTP Virus Scanning drop-down
Click Update
